Door Removal/Bolt Upgrade?
eaglescout526 replied to CrustyBoy's topic in MJ Tech: Modification and Repairs
I remember jeepdriver long ago had a hack where you take one of those torx bits like what you put in a screw or a drill and a 1/4” wrench and put the box end on the bit and you’ll have a good tool that’ll squeeze in there well without complex work arounds. -

Steering column rebuild
eaglescout526 replied to KBRAY88MJ's topic in MJ Tech: Modification and Repairs
Try looking up info about Saginaw columns. GMs of the same era used them as well so those Chevy guys ought to have a detailed walk through on rebuilding these columns.
